This recipe was extracted from Instruction in cookery (Methuen's text-books, Thompson) (1908) by A. P. Thompson, page 39. The excerpt below is the record exactly as published.
Albumin Water— Beat the white of 1 egg to destroy the membranes. Pass through a canvas bag, and add a little less than J pint of cold boiled water. Add a squeeze of lemon if allowed
